Smart Furnace Not Turning On: Diagnosing Power and Thermostat Issues

When your smart comfort furnace fails to power up, the first step is verifying the power supply. Make sure the furnace is plugged in and that the circuit breaker hasn’t tripped, as power interruptions are common causes. Some furnaces have an emergency shutoff switch near the unit—check if it is in the correct position.

The thermostat controls the furnace operation, so ensuring the thermostat is set correctly and has working batteries is crucial. Smart thermostats sometimes lose connection with the furnace or Wi-Fi, which prevents activation. Restarting the thermostat or re-syncing it to your home network might resolve this issue.

Inconsistent Heating: Filters, Vents, and Thermostat Connectivity

One leading cause of inconsistent or insufficient heating is a clogged air filter, which restricts airflow and reduces furnace efficiency. Regularly changing or cleaning the filter — typically every 1-3 months — is essential. Also, inspect vents and registers to ensure they are open, clean, and unblocked by furniture or debris.

Smart furnace thermostats rely on steady connectivity to regulate temperature. If the thermostat fails to communicate properly with the furnace, heating may become erratic. Verify the thermostat app for any error messages and check your Wi-Fi network to ensure a strong signal.

Troubleshooting Smart Furnace Wi-Fi and Connectivity Problems

Connectivity is vital for smart comfort furnaces, allowing remote control, diagnostics, and energy management. When the furnace loses Wi-Fi connection, first restart your router and the thermostat device to refresh their network links. Firmware updates from the manufacturer often fix bugs related to connectivity, so check if your furnace system requires any updates via the smartphone app.

If your furnace is located far from the router or inside a dense wall, the Wi-Fi signal may be weak. Consider relocating the router closer to the furnace or using network extenders like mesh systems to strengthen coverage. Consistent connectivity prevents heating interruptions and enables efficient remote control.

Addressing Unusual Noises from Your Smart Comfort Furnace

Strange sounds such as rattling, banging, or squealing can signal mechanical issues in your furnace. Loose screws, bolts, or panels often cause rattling, which can be fixed by tightening hardware. Squealing may indicate problems with the blower motor or belts, possibly needing lubrication or replacement.

Debris inside the furnace housing can also produce noise and impair function. Regular cleaning and inspection remove dirt and foreign objects that might block moving parts, thereby extending the lifespan of your smart furnace.

Frequent Cycling Issue: Causes and Maintenance Tips

Frequent turning on and off, known as short cycling, stresses the furnace and can increase energy costs. This often results from thermostat errors, overheating, or restricted airflow. Test the thermostat by setting it to a fixed temperature and observing the furnace operation. If the problem persists, recalibration or replacement may be necessary.

Clogged air filters significantly contribute to short cycling by limiting airflow. Replace filters promptly and check for duct blockages or closed vents. Proper airflow prevents overheating and allows the furnace to maintain steady heating intervals.

When to Contact a Professional HVAC Technician

While basic troubleshooting can resolve many common issues, some situations require expert assistance. Gas furnace problems, persistent errors, or unusual smells demand immediate professional attention for safety and effectiveness. If your furnace repeatedly fails to respond after basic fixes, or you encounter error codes you cannot clear, contacting an HVAC technician is advisable.

Technicians can perform in-depth diagnostics, repair complex electronics, and ensure your smart furnace operates safely and efficiently, protecting your home comfort throughout the heating season.
